Well, we here at CraveOnline have more bad news for you, Gears of War will be adding new playable maps as well as achievements for the ‘annex’ game play style.

For 800 X-Box Live points, a four map package titled ‘Hidden Fronts’ can be downloaded for online play. For most players this is a must, considering the alternative is either hosting one’s own match or always being in danger of being booted off of a match because the host has downloaded content. With the new achievements added to the ‘annex’ game it is possible to accrue 250 points, to add even more to the downloads value. As an added bonus, Epic Games has managed to fix the ‘roadie run’ feature so that players have an easier time maneuvering while dodging gunfire, grenades, and the usual body parts of your eradicated brethren.

If you don’t feel like paying for the points, then wait until early September for the chance to download the maps for free. But, by then other gamers will know those stages like the backs of their hands and use that knowledge to destroy you. So, it’s really up to you, happy hunting!
